Rainbow House - Entire Place

Relax in luxury at Rainbow House and enjoy peaceful surroundings. Featuring a 50sqm bedroom with a king sized bed and en-suite bathroom, Downstairs enjoy the cozy snug with a bookshelf and smart TV. Upstairs is workstation with an Italian leather chair to work in comfort, a relaxing reading chair, sofa and mood lighting, along with six large velux windows creating an airy feel throughout the day and night. This beautifully designed and sympathetically restored barn conversion features many original features, and Rainbow House dates back to 1908 where it was an integral part of the town as Rainbow Farm providing a milking place for the local milk man Fred Rainbow. This lovely property is situated 2 minutes walk from Lutterworth town centre with various shops, cafe’s, restaurants and pubs, all within easy walking distance.
